Puedes utilizar segmentos
campos para
la segmentación en rendimiento
informes.
Por ejemplo, consultar por marketingMethod
devuelve un informe con una fila para
cada método de marketing y el
métricas que
especificar para ese método de marketing en la cláusula SELECT
.
Al igual que con los informes personalizados de Merchant Center, puedes especificar varios segmentos en la misma consulta con la API de Merchant Reports.
Aquí encontrarás una consulta de ejemplo que muestra los clics de todos los productos de tu cuenta.
durante un período de 30 días, segmentado por marketingMethod
y offerId
:
SELECT marketingMethod, offerId, clicks
FROM ProductPerformanceView
WHERE date BETWEEN '2020-11-01' AND '2020-11-30'
La respuesta de esta consulta incluye una fila para cada combinación de offerId
y marketingMethod
, que representa la cantidad de clics de esa combinación:
{
"results": [
{
"productPerformanceView": {
"marketingMethod": "ADS",
"offerId": "12345",
"clicks": "38"
}
},
{
"productPerformanceView": {
"marketingMethod": "ADS",
"offerId": "12346",
"clicks": "125"
}
},
{
"productPerformanceView": {
"marketingMethod": "ORGANIC",
"offerId": "12346",
"clicks": "23"
}
},
{
"productPerformanceView": {
"marketingMethod": "ADS",
"offerId": "12347",
"clicks": "8"
}
},
{
"productPerformanceView": {
"marketingMethod": "ORGANIC",
"offerId": "12347",
"clicks": "3"
}
}
]
}
Categoría y tipo de producto
La consulta de Merchant Center El idioma admite la segmentación. en función de dos grupos de atributos que puedes definir para organizar tus inventario:
- Niveles de categoría
- Categorías del producto de Google taxonomía. Google podría asignar automáticamente la categoría a tu producto si no se proporcionó ninguna. definir mejor la categoría proporcionada.
- Niveles de tipo de producto
- Los tipos de productos que asignas según tu categorización. A diferencia de no hay un conjunto predefinido de valores admitidos.
Tanto los atributos de categoría como de tipo de producto se organizan en una jerarquía con
varios niveles. El producto
especificación separa
con el carácter >
, pero tú seleccionas cada nivel de la jerarquía
por separado en los informes.
Por ejemplo, considera un producto con los siguientes niveles de tipo de producto:
Home & Garden > Kitchen & Dining > Kitchen Appliances > Refrigerators
Los informes muestran cada nivel en su propio campo:
Segmento | Valor |
---|---|
product_type_l1 |
Home & Garden |
product_type_l2 |
Kitchen & Dining |
product_type_l3 |
Kitchen Appliances |
product_type_l4 |
Refrigerators |
Métricas de moneda y precio
Las métricas de precios, como conversionValue
, se representan con el atributo
Price
el tipo de letra. Si la métrica está disponible en varias monedas, el valor de cada una
currency se muestra en una fila separada. Por ejemplo, la siguiente consulta:
SELECT conversionValue
FROM ProductPerformanceView
WHERE date = '2020-11-01'
devuelve los siguientes resultados:
{
"results": [
{
"productPerformanceView": {
"conversionValue": {
"amountMicros": "150000000",
"currencyCode": "USD"
}
}
},
{
"productPerformanceView": {
"conversionValue": {
"amountMicros": "70000000",
"currencyCode": "CAD"
}
}
}
]
}
Si solicitas métricas de precio y métricas que no son de precio en una consulta, las métricas de precios se muestran en filas de resultados separadas de las métricas que no son de precios, una fila de resultados por código de moneda. Por ejemplo, la siguiente consulta:
SELECT conversions, conversionValue
FROM ProductPerformanceView
WHERE date = '2020-11-01'
devuelve la siguiente respuesta:
{
"results": [
{
"productPerformanceView": {
"conversions": "27",
"conversionValue": {
"amountMicros": "0",
"currencyCode": ""
}
}
},
{
"productPerformanceView": {
"conversions": "0",
"conversionValue": {
"amountMicros": "150000000",
"currencyCode": "USD"
}
}
},
{
"productPerformanceView": {
"conversions": "0",
"conversionValue": {
"amountMicros": "70000000",
"currencyCode": "CAD"
}
}
}
]
}
Todos los campos que seleccionas se muestran en la respuesta, incluso si su valor sigue el valor predeterminado o cero.